The nurse is assisting a client with his meal selection for the next day. The client states, "I can't have meat tomorrow, it's a Holy Day." The nurse recognizes that the client is a member of which religious organization?
A) Orthodox Jewish
B) Reform Jewish
C) Roman Catholic
D) Islamic
Ans: C
Feedback:
Roman Catholics observe fasting and abstinence from meat on certain Holy Days.
